About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Assist with design of steel, concrete and masonry structures
  • Analyze the capacity of existing structures and design reinforcement when required
  • Collaborate with senior and junior engineers
  • Participate in design meetings with owners, architects and other consultants
  • Participate in construction site meetings
  • Conduct construction site visits to review work for general compliance with structural drawings and contract documents
  • Assist the design team with structural design for residential, commercial, industrial and institutional projects

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Degree in Structural Engineering from a recognized university
  • Preferably 1 - 3 years’ experience in structural engineering with a focus on structural analysis and design in buildings
  • Experience with NBCC and CSA standards
  • Field experience on construction sites, conducting general reviews for compliance with drawings and specifications, and writing site reports
  • Experience with Etabs, SAFE, SAP and other similar structural design software
  • Proven ability to work independently with minimum direction
  • Commitment and dedication to client service and technical excellence
  • Effective communication skills and ability to handle changing needs while working effectively with diverse groups
  • Strategic thinking ability to determine required work and draw rational conclusions from available information
  • A valid driver’s license is required
